Abstract
The Superfund Amendments and Reauthorization Act of 1986 (SARA), which amended CERCLA, provides under section 117(e) an important new component of EPA's community relations activities at Superfund sites--technical assistance grants to affected groups. The purpose of these grants is to assist citizens' groups in understanding technical information that assesses potential hazards and the selection and design of appropriate response actions at Superfund sites. This manual outlines Federal policies, procedures, and regulations related to the Technical Assistance Grant Program and provides instructions on how to complete Federal grant forms. If a State administers the Technical Assistance Grant Program, the State may have additional procedures and requirements that affect citizens' groups applying for grants within that State. Groups, therefore, should contact the appropriate State representative for specific information. This manual is designed to help citizens' groups apply for and manage a technical assistance grant. It is written as a self-help guide in an easy-to-understand manner. Step-by-step instructions for completing various forms are included throughout the manual.
